What is an Emergency Car Key Locksmith?
An emergency car key locksmith is a customized company who assists drivers in opening their automobiles and producing brand-new car keys in urgent scenarios. Unlike regular locksmiths who mainly deal with domestic and commercial locks, car key locksmith professionals are trained to deal with the complex lock systems found in modern vehicles. They can open car doors, develop new keys, and even program key fobs, all while ensuring the security and security of your vehicle.

Services Offered by Emergency Car Key Locksmiths
Emergency car key locksmith professionals offer a vast array of services to assist you in times of requirement. Some of the most typical services include:
- Car Unlocking: If you lock your keys inside the car, a locksmith can unlock the doors without triggering damage.
- Key Cutting: They can develop a brand-new key for your vehicle, whether you've lost your initial or require an additional copy.
- Key Programming: Modern cars often use transponder keys, which need to be programmed to the vehicle's computer system. A locksmith can do this for you.
- Ignition Repair: If your key is harmed or the ignition is malfunctioning, a locksmith can repair or replace the required parts.
- Lock Cylinder Replacement: In cases where the lock cylinder is damaged or broken, a locksmith can replace it and offer you with a brand-new key.
- Keyless Entry System Repair: For lorries with keyless entry systems, a locksmith can detect and fix problems with the sensors and receivers.

Frequently Asked Questions About Emergency Car Key Locksmiths
What should I do if I lock my type in the car?
- Stay calm and assess the circumstance. If the car remains in a safe place, call an emergency car key locksmith. They will arrive quickly to open your vehicle without causing damage.
Can a locksmith make a new key if I've lost the original?
- Yes, an expert locksmith can produce a new key using your vehicle's VIN number or by utilizing a code from the vehicle's manufacturer.
Are emergency situation car key locksmiths more pricey than routine locksmith professionals?
- Normally, emergency car key locksmith professionals might charge more due to the specific nature of their services and the seriousness of the scenario. Nevertheless, they are frequently more cost-effective than hauling your vehicle to a car dealership.
For how long does it take for a locksmith to arrive?
- Many reliable emergency situation car key locksmiths aim to show up within 30 minutes to an hour, depending on your place and their existing work.
Can a locksmith aid with keyless entry system issues?
- Yes, many locksmiths are trained to diagnose and repair keyless entry systems, consisting of concerns with sensing units and receivers.
What should I try to find in a locksmith's qualifications?
- Make sure the locksmith is certified by the appropriate state or local authorities. Furthermore, inspect if they are bonded and guaranteed to safeguard you from any liabilities.
